Home
last modified time | relevance | path

Searched refs:data (Results 151 – 175 of 358) sorted by relevance

12345678910>>...15

/art/runtime/
Dmodule_exclusion_test.cc152 std::string data = package + '\n'; in TEST_F() local
153 ASSERT_TRUE(package_list_file.GetFile()->WriteFully(data.data(), data.size())); in TEST_F()
Ddebugger.cc187 const ArrayRef<const jbyte>& data, in DdmHandleChunk() argument
190 ScopedLocalRef<jbyteArray> dataArray(env, env->NewByteArray(data.size())); in DdmHandleChunk()
192 LOG(WARNING) << "byte[] allocation failed: " << data.size(); in DdmHandleChunk()
198 data.size(), in DdmHandleChunk()
199 reinterpret_cast<const jbyte*>(data.data())); in DdmHandleChunk()
206 type, dataArray.get(), 0, data.size())); in DdmHandleChunk()
253 reinterpret_cast<jbyte*>(out_data->data())); in DdmHandleChunk()
794 : data(data_in), hash(ComputeModifiedUtf8Hash(data_in)), index(0) { in Entry()
800 const char* data; member
810 return strcmp(data, other.data) == 0; in operator ==()
[all …]
/art/compiler/
Dcommon_compiler_test.cc83 const void* unaligned_code_ptr = chunk->data() + (size - code_size); in MakeExecutable()
90 CHECK_EQ(code_ptr, static_cast<const void*>(chunk->data() + (chunk->size() - code_size))); in MakeExecutable()
106 uintptr_t data = reinterpret_cast<uintptr_t>(code_start); in MakeExecutable() local
107 uintptr_t base = RoundDown(data, kPageSize); in MakeExecutable()
108 uintptr_t limit = RoundUp(data + code_length, kPageSize); in MakeExecutable()
/art/runtime/jit/
Djit_memory_region.cc357 DCHECK(IsInExecSpace(reserved_code.data())); in CommitCode()
369 uint8_t* x_memory = const_cast<uint8_t*>(reserved_code.data()); in CommitCode()
453 DCHECK(IsInDataSpace(reserved_data.data())); in CommitData()
454 uint8_t* roots_data = GetWritableDataAddress(reserved_data.data()); in CommitData()
459 memcpy(stack_map_data, stack_map.data(), stack_map.size()); in CommitData()
494 void JitMemoryRegion::FreeData(const uint8_t* data) { in FreeData() argument
495 FreeWritableData(GetWritableDataAddress(data)); in FreeData()
/art/test/472-unreachable-if-regression/
Dinfo.txt3 Also tests a packed-switch with negative offset to its data.
/art/dexlayout/
Ddexlayout.cc259 static void Asciify(char* out, const unsigned char* data, size_t len) { in Asciify() argument
261 if (*data < 0x20) { in Asciify()
263 switch (*data) { in Asciify()
276 } else if (*data >= 0x80) { in Asciify()
279 *out++ = *data; in Asciify()
281 data++; in Asciify()
505 void DexLayout::DumpEncodedValue(const dex_ir::EncodedValue* data) { in DumpEncodedValue() argument
506 switch (data->Type()) { in DumpEncodedValue()
508 fprintf(out_file_, "%" PRId8, data->GetByte()); in DumpEncodedValue()
511 fprintf(out_file_, "%" PRId16, data->GetShort()); in DumpEncodedValue()
[all …]
/art/test/ti-agent/
Dsuspension_helper.cc61 threads.data(), in Java_art_Suspension_resumeList()
82 threads.data(), in Java_art_Suspension_suspendList()
/art/libprofile/profile/
Dprofile_compilation_info.cc427 if (!WriteBuffer(fd, buffer.data(), buffer.size())) { in Save()
493 std::unique_ptr<uint8_t[]> compressed_buffer = DeflateBuffer(buffer.data(), in Save()
506 if (!WriteBuffer(fd, buffer.data(), buffer.size())) { in Save()
717 DexFileData* const data = GetOrAddDexFileData(pmi.ref.dex_file, annotation); in AddMethod() local
718 if (data == nullptr) { // checksum mismatch in AddMethod()
721 if (!data->AddMethod(flags, pmi.ref.index)) { in AddMethod()
734 InlineCacheMap* inline_cache = data->FindOrAddHotMethod(pmi.ref.index); in AddMethod()
834 DexFileData* const data = GetOrAddDexFileData(line_header.profile_key, in ReadMethods() local
841 InlineCacheMap* inline_cache = data->FindOrAddHotMethod(method_index); in ReadMethods()
877 DexFileData* const data = GetOrAddDexFileData(line_header.profile_key, in ReadClasses() local
[all …]
/art/compiler/optimizing/
Doptimizing_unit_test.h155 HGraph* CreateCFG(const std::vector<uint16_t>& data,
161 const size_t code_item_size = data.size() * sizeof(data.front());
163 memcpy(aligned_data, &data[0], code_item_size);
Dinliner.cc1616 DCHECK_EQ(inline_method.d.data, 0u); in TryPatternSubstitution()
1619 *return_replacement = graph_->GetIntConstant(static_cast<int32_t>(inline_method.d.data)); in TryPatternSubstitution()
1623 const InlineIGetIPutData& data = inline_method.d.ifield_data; in TryPatternSubstitution() local
1624 if (data.method_is_static || data.object_arg != 0u) { in TryPatternSubstitution()
1628 HInstruction* obj = GetInvokeInputForArgVRegIndex(invoke_instruction, data.object_arg); in TryPatternSubstitution()
1629 HInstanceFieldGet* iget = CreateInstanceFieldGet(data.field_idx, resolved_method, obj); in TryPatternSubstitution()
1630 DCHECK_EQ(iget->GetFieldOffset().Uint32Value(), data.field_offset); in TryPatternSubstitution()
1631 DCHECK_EQ(iget->IsVolatile() ? 1u : 0u, data.is_volatile); in TryPatternSubstitution()
1637 const InlineIGetIPutData& data = inline_method.d.ifield_data; in TryPatternSubstitution() local
1638 if (data.method_is_static || data.object_arg != 0u) { in TryPatternSubstitution()
[all …]
/art/build/
DAndroid.common_path.mk24 ART_TARGET_DALVIK_CACHE_DIR := /data/dalvik-cache
30 ART_TARGET_NATIVETEST_DIR := /data/$(notdir $(TARGET_OUT_DATA_NATIVE_TESTS))/art
35 ART_TARGET_TEST_DIR := /data/art-test
/art/libdexfile/external/include/art_api/
Ddex_file_support.h56 : ext_string_(MakeExtDexFileString(str.data(), str.size())) {} in DexString()
64 const char* data() const { in data() function
68 const char* c_str() const { return data(); } in c_str()
/art/tools/
Dsymbolize.sh56 FILES=$(adbshellstrip find /data -name "'*.oat'" -o -name "'*.dex'" -o -name "'*.odex'")
/art/compiler/driver/
Dcompiled_method_storage.cc58 const ArrayRef<const T>& data, in AllocateOrDeduplicateArray() argument
60 if (data.empty()) { in AllocateOrDeduplicateArray()
63 return CopyArray(swap_space_.get(), data); in AllocateOrDeduplicateArray()
65 return dedupe_set->Add(Thread::Current(), data); in AllocateOrDeduplicateArray()
/art/compiler/debug/dwarf/
Ddwarf_test.cc127 ArrayRef<const uint8_t>(*opcodes.data()), in TEST_F()
143 ArrayRef<const uint8_t>(*opcodes.data()), in TEST_F()
184 ArrayRef<const uint8_t>(*opcodes.data()), in TEST_F()
278 EXPECT_LT(opcodes.data()->size(), num_rows * 3); in TEST_F()
/art/tools/ahat/src/main/com/android/ahat/proguard/
DProguardMap.java107 FrameData data = mFrames.get(key); in addFrame() local
108 if (data == null) { in addFrame()
109 data = new FrameData(clearMethodName); in addFrame()
111 data.lineNumbers.put( in addFrame()
113 mFrames.put(key, data); in addFrame()
/art/dex2oat/linker/
Doat_writer.cc193 source_ = dexlayout_data_.data(); in SetDexLayoutData()
637 bool OatWriter::AddRawDexFileSource(const ArrayRef<const uint8_t>& data, in AddRawDexFileSource() argument
642 if (data.size() < sizeof(DexFile::Header)) { in AddRawDexFileSource()
644 << data.size() << " File: " << location; in AddRawDexFileSource()
647 if (!ValidateDexFileHeader(data.data(), location)) { in AddRawDexFileSource()
650 const UnalignedDexFileHeader* header = AsUnalignedDexFileHeader(data.data()); in AddRawDexFileSource()
651 if (data.size() < header->file_size_) { in AddRawDexFileSource()
652 LOG(ERROR) << "Truncated dex file data. Data size: " << data.size() in AddRawDexFileSource()
659 DexFileSource(data.data()), in AddRawDexFileSource()
1379 const uint8_t* code_info = compiled_method->GetVmapTable().data(); in VisitMethod()
[all …]
Drelative_patcher.cc139 if (UNLIKELY(!out->WriteFully(thunk.data(), thunk.size()))) { in WriteThunk()
147 if (UNLIKELY(!out->WriteFully(thunk.data(), thunk.size()))) { in WriteMiscThunk()
/art/libdexfile/dex/
Dtest_dex_file_builder.h88 uint8_t data[sizeof(DexFile::Header)]; in Build() member
91 std::memset(header_data.data, 0, sizeof(header_data.data)); in Build()
92 DexFile::Header* header = reinterpret_cast<DexFile::Header*>(&header_data.data); in Build()
222 std::memcpy(&dex_file_data_[0], header_data.data, sizeof(DexFile::Header)); in Build()
227 dex_file_data_.data() + skip, in Build()
231 std::memcpy(&dex_file_data_[0], header_data.data, sizeof(DexFile::Header)); in Build()
/art/openjdkjvmti/
Dti_class_definition.h89 memcpy(dex_data_memory_.data(), new_dex_data, new_dex_len); in SetNewDexData()
141 dex_data_.data() == dex_data_mmap_.Begin() && in IsLazyDefinition()
Dti_object.cc121 reinterpret_cast<const unsigned char*>(wait.data()), in GetObjectMonitorUsage()
128 reinterpret_cast<const unsigned char*>(notify_wait.data()), in GetObjectMonitorUsage()
/art/runtime/arch/arm/
Dinstruction_set_features_arm.cc224 void* data) { in bad_instr_handle() argument
226 struct ucontext *uc = (struct ucontext *)data; in bad_instr_handle()
231 UNUSED(data); in bad_instr_handle()
/art/tools/dexfuzz/src/dexfuzz/rawdex/
DDexRandomAccessFile.java288 public void writeDexUtf(byte[] data) throws IOException { in writeDexUtf() argument
289 write(data); in writeDexUtf()
/art/runtime/jni/
Djava_vm_ext.h73 void SetCheckJniAbortHook(void (*hook)(void*, const std::string&), void* data) { in SetCheckJniAbortHook() argument
75 check_jni_abort_hook_data_ = data; in SetCheckJniAbortHook()
229 void (*check_jni_abort_hook_)(void* data, const std::string& reason);
/art/tools/jvmti-agents/enable-vlog/
DREADME.md91 > `adb push $ANDROID_PRODUCT_OUT/system/lib64/libenablevlog.so /data/local/tmp/`
93 > `adb shell am start-activity --attach-agent /data/local/tmp/libenablevlog.so=class,jit some.de…

12345678910>>...15